User Review: Kelty Men's Coyote 4750

Rating: rated 5 of 5 stars
Source: bought it new
Price Paid: $85

Summary

Very well constructed. Excellent load carrying capacity.

Pros

  • Excellent load carrying engineering.
  • Excellent materials used.

Cons

  • Loading in front pocket will put strain on the zippers.

Bought it from campmor on a sale about 2 years ago for $85. Getting the backpack to sit on your hips makes for a comfy journey thus waist size is critical.

I have a tendency to load up the backpack on trips n typically it weighs ~55 pounds. While loading I make sure that the weight is balanced. I don't really feel the weight. It's very comfortable.

I typically put in a footprint for the tent, the tent itself, a sleeping bag, my clothes, n food in the main pocket. The side pockets hold water bottles - 1 litre each. The top pockets - flashlights, headlamps, emergency lamps, snacks, etc. Capacity is as advertised.

I have used it for two years now, and although i have not misused it it has definetly lived up to my expectations - with the design, material, construction, capacity and price.
